July is the highlight month this year at Hanover Raceway.
Without question the signature event each & every year at the track is the Dream of Glory Final, a $ 100,000 race where the winner pockets half the purse, all of which is followed by a spectacular fireworks show.
That’s not to say there aren’t significant events along the way, like Saturday night when the Ontario Sire Stakes return to Hanover Raceway
Tomorrow night there will be four Sire Stakes Grassroots division races for the two-year-old trotting colts with $24,000 in purse money on the line in each of those races.
Naturally, for a regional operation like Hanover Raceway, there’s always greater interest on the entries from our area.
For example, in Race 2, the McNair Family of Walkerton have ” Have Happy Trails Sonny ” entered with Randy Fritz driving
Meanwhile, Kaye Laverty of Sauble Beach is the owner of ” JLs Time’s R Good ” who will run in the 4th, and also owns ” Bliss Little Duke ” who competes in the 6th.
One other note regarding the card Saturday is that fans can participate in the ” Win The Thrill ” promotion by filling out a ballot that could eventually lead them to a share in the Standardbred Breeders of Ontario Association New Owner Mentoring program.
Post time tomorrow night is 7:20 at Hanover Raceway.
